Output 59bb3636b2dab8cc328f35780fa3d2df8d392686f16b3f6ef88d79011f243f3b:1

value
3270669
script pubkey
OP_0 OP_PUSHBYTES_20 e89a7f9308871dd7c28cc41be2d414b206a5baa5
address
bc1qazd8lycgsuwa0s5vcsd794q5kgr2tw49ttxt5z
transaction
59bb3636b2dab8cc328f35780fa3d2df8d392686f16b3f6ef88d79011f243f3b
spent
true